Output f34f17caf507fb0149fe7ecb3a62817dc68b8a7c7bece0e6df47bb70c2a4c833:0

value
2927943
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f221373c73e9a3862067eeeb4b3ac724e044b746 OP_EQUAL
address
3PmHEqbLUMybdUqayEEhAG9gHmYWgfveQF
transaction
f34f17caf507fb0149fe7ecb3a62817dc68b8a7c7bece0e6df47bb70c2a4c833